Why These Are the Top Subaru Repair Auto Repair Shops in Braggadocio

** The Subaru repair market directly servicing Braggadocio is virtually non-existent due to the town's small size. Residents must look to neighboring commercial hubs like Caruthersville (approx. 12 miles away) and Sikeston (approx. 25 miles away) for qualified service. The **average quality** of Subaru-specific service in this region is good, with several shops demonstrating competent knowledge of common issues like head gaskets and AWD systems. However, expertise in the most advanced areas (like official EyeSight calibration and complex hybrid systems) is concentrated in only 1-2 top-tier shops, necessitating careful selection. **Competition level** is moderate in the wider region, which helps maintain reasonable pricing and incentivizes shops to acquire Subaru-specific expertise to differentiate themselves. **Typical pricing** for specialized Subaru work is in line with national averages for independent shops, generally 20-30% lower than a dealership. A complex job like a head gasket replacement on a non-turbo Subaru engine typically ranges from $2,200 - $3,000, while CVT fluid service is between $250 - $400. It is highly recommended to contact these shops directly for quotes on specific services.

What are the most common Subaru repair issues for drivers in the Braggadocio area?

Given the rural roads and potential for muddy conditions around Braggadocio, common issues include premature wear on suspension components like control arms and struts, as well as CV joint and axle boot damage from dirt and debris. Subaru's signature Boxer engines also often require attention to head gaskets and oil consumption as they age, which is a critical repair for local long-distance driving.

How can I find a quality, trustworthy Subaru repair shop near Braggadocio?

Since Braggadocio is a small community, you may need to look at shops in nearby towns like Hayti or Caruthersville. Look for shops that are Subaru-specific or have technicians with ASE certification and explicit experience with all-wheel-drive systems. Checking online reviews from other Southeast Missouri drivers and asking for local recommendations are the best ways to find reliable service.

Are Subaru repair costs higher in our rural area compared to larger cities?

Labor rates in the Braggadocio region may be slightly lower than in major metro areas, but parts availability can sometimes influence cost and timing. For specialized Subaru parts, a local shop may need to order them, which could add a day to the repair compared to a city with a dealership. It's always wise to get a detailed estimate upfront.

When should I seek service for my Subaru's all-wheel-drive system given our local driving conditions?

You should have the AWD system checked if you notice unusual binding or jerking when turning, especially after navigating the muddy farm roads or uneven terrain common in the Bootheel. Regular servicing of the differential and transmission fluids is also crucial, as harsh conditions can cause faster degradation.

What local factors should I consider when maintaining my Subaru in Braggadocio?

The flat but often poorly maintained rural roads and frequent agricultural traffic mean you should pay extra attention to wheel alignments and tire integrity to prevent uneven wear. Furthermore, the high humidity and temperature swings of Southeast Missouri can accelerate corrosion, making undercarriage inspections and brake service more frequent necessities.
